Output ce54bf2d29fa91331abde4a7dbc1841a56118cb6c91135a4df4440507434dbeb:12

value
159666902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db827a7c90dadd4673b701c82d28488b0e5ca339 OP_EQUAL
address
3MhgDMfnj9c8jrTAX3R2xwdpYzDdCqqPQi
transaction
ce54bf2d29fa91331abde4a7dbc1841a56118cb6c91135a4df4440507434dbeb
spent
true